## Customer-Concentration Risk — Hallern Fabrics (Managers Only)

For branch managers: one account, the Quillster retail chain, now represents 38% of annual revenue, up from 24% two years ago. Contract renewal lands in Q1, and terms are expected to tighten. Branches should diversify pipelines now rather than waiting for the renewal outcome. Mitigation targets per branch are in the shared tracker and will be reviewed monthly. Leadership's position on managing this exposure is stated below.

internal memo for kaduf-baduf: Only 35 of the 378 pilot accounts renewed Holir, so a churn review is set for June 11. Eliielax Group is in early talks to buy Silaelix Group for about $142.1 million.

# Ledgerbin Environments

Ledgerbin partitions the transactions table by calendar month. Staging keeps three partitions; production keeps eighteen. Partitions roll automatically at midnight UTC on the first. Never drop a partition manually — use the retention job. Queries missing a month predicate will scan everything, so don't. Each environment reads the following configuration:

deployment values, kahof-yadug:
[gorys]
team = silael
access_code = ac_00d620
owner = istox.oliys
host = gorys.torvastack.example
port = 9000
peer = holmir.merlaqsoft.example
salt = 9fdae78a
pin = 2358

Handover for on-call: the Marrowbase query planner regression from build 4.12 causes nested-loop joins on tables over 10M rows when stats are stale. Workaround is forcing an analyze on the affected tables; a proper fix lands Thursday. Alerts fire as slow-query spikes on the Velting cluster. Affected query signatures and the rollback procedure are documented on the internal page below.

wiki page, tajep-kadug: https://superset.sivrelcloud.example/pages/ticket/settings/display/30cd77c7dbb08942

The rounding drift in Ledgerbeam's currency conversion comes from applying the spread before quantizing to minor units. We now round once, at the final step, using banker's rounding per the Varno finance spec. This eliminates the off-by-one cent cases QA flagged in the peso paths. The constants governing precision and spread are below.

tuning constants:
QUOTAS = {
    "druwyn": 5,
    "holix": 5,
    "zorath": 5,
    "holwyn": 10,
}